Output 4fccd8564d83ecddc60d8afa47841aa24bf048df18e8f918cbb97bc2f129b43d:1

value
60000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f90b292acdb862a7c3de827704e4dc18ff8c3e2f OP_EQUAL
address
3QPqYmyFaaifaWpNRCG221KxX5g2eucmD6
transaction
4fccd8564d83ecddc60d8afa47841aa24bf048df18e8f918cbb97bc2f129b43d
confirmations
352034
spent
true